[RESOLVED] Select customers on Province-wide talk plans experiencing outbound call issues

Alan_K
Deputy Mayor / Adjoint au Maire

Most Recent Update

 

19:30 ET - March 19, 2019

 

Hey Community,

 

Earlier today we identified an issue affecting select customers on Province-wide talk plans in which outbound phone calls were unable to be placed. Inbound calling, texting and data services remained unaffected.

 

Our technical teams are implementing a solution which will restore outbound calling service to normal by early morning of March 20. No action is required on your behalf.

 

However, in the meantime, we have added a complimentary 400 minutes Long Distance Talk Add-On (includes calls to Canada & the U.S) for our affected customers, which you can use immediately and will allow you to make outbound calls. This Add-On will not expire as any unused minutes will roll over to your next cycle.

 

We understand that your service and staying connected is important and we sincerely apologize for any inconvenience this may have caused and thank you for your patience.

13:30 ET - March 19, 2019

 

Hey Community,

 

We’ve identified an issue affecting select customers on Province-wide talk plans in which outbound phone calls are unable to placed. Currently, this looks to be isolated only to Quebec.

 

If you’re currently experiencing this issue, please note that inbound calling, texting, and data services remain unaffected. Meanwhile, wi-fi calling services and inbound calling may meet your talk needs temporarily.

 

Our technical team has identified the source of the issue and is working to restore service as quickly as possible. We will provide updates as we learn more.

 

We apologize for any inconvenience caused and thank you for your patience.
